Whilst at my local dealers I viewed the i20.

Here are my thoughts... for what they are worth.

First off I noticed it was bigger than the Getz it is replacing.  I'd say Getz plus 25% and i30 minus 10% - about the size of the accent I had previously.

I liked the shape and believe it or not the interior is quite spacey and well laid out.

I didn't like the feel in the seats. Felt very hards, even on the top model, but plenty of leg space in front and back.

Boot plentiful. I'd say space about 0.75% of the i30's boot space and 200% bigger than the i10.  Just the right size for those trips to the supermarket and would hold 4/5 medium size luggage case.

Price. Well ......  in the UK they are discounting the i30 at present and you can get a 1.4 petrol and the 1.4 SE i30 cheaper than the 1.4 petrol i20.

Although they do a 1.2 petrol in the range I think that engine would be under power for the car with 3+ passengers/luggage, although with 1 or 2 passengers it might be OK for short trips.

They mentioned that there is a diesel due and at 90ps (i30 115ps) I think that engine may be popular.

It doesn't have ESP but you can add it as an extra for £250.  If I was asked I'd say add it on for that extra safe handling.

Overall, its seems to be a car to fill the gap between the small size car market and the larger family size car.

I might be tempted in a few years when my i30 is due a change.

ESP will be standard from April onwards to comply with new NCAP rules, and a price increase to take account of the ESP.
